      Just did a live upgrade from 2.0.3 to 2.1.0 and all seems to have gone well except every page in the webGUI has a big red box at the top warning not to make any changes since packages are being upgraded in the background. Problem is this warning has been showing over 30 minutes and pfSense doesn't actually seem to be installing anything.

      How long should this take?

        It can take much longer than you think. At least much longer than I expected.  ;) 2.1 is using self contained pbi files that contain all the package dependencies and as such are much larger than in 2.0.3. If you have a slow connection or slow flash media this can take some time.
        If it really has become stuck you can use the 'Clear package lock' button in Diagnostics: Backup/Restore:
        You should check the logs if you do use that to make sure the packages installed correctly.
